Abstract

288,361. Claydon, G. T. Jan. 3, 1927. Buoyant life-saving chambers.-A lifeboat for transporting the crew of a disabled submarine to the surface is accommodated in a recess G, Fig. 20, in the hull and is entered from the interior of the submarine by way of a compartment K, Fig. 19, and a tube P which is closed at its end by a door whilst the port in the stern of the boat is closed by a door A. Both these doors as well as a door in the hatchway M in the cover of the boat are operated by mechanism comprising a lever C, Fig. 1, which moves the spider B over inclines L on the frame. The lifeboat is secured in its recess by coupling-members E which engage with recesses F in the sides of the. boat and arelocked therein by cams O which are simultaneously operated through suitable linkwork from a centrally disposed control lever in the boat. The lifeboat resks on chocks H adjacent to. which are drainage tubes J.
